"Much" of a noise increase is a pretty vague term. I have headers on mine and you can whisper a conversation in my Z. I have full sound deadening treatment though. My answer would be, get the headers and if it's too loud, add MLV. Done.
If you aren't planning any other mods, I'd stick with what you have. Now when/if you do heads and cam, then you'll want the long tubes. I have long tubes on my heads/cam LS3. With 3" non catted midpipes leading to ZR1 cans, you can't hear any exhaust at cruise or accelerating casually. It will wake the dead when you get on it though.

Even without the "worked" heads, you're leaving quite a bit on the table. LS7 heads are bad *** as they come from the factory. That's a nice healthy cam and a big improvement over the stocker. Headers aren't that big of a pain to install. Just get the correct midpipes and it will all bolt together with your stock mufflers.
